Exciting Changes to Our Phone System, Improving Your Experience

From 2nd June 2026 we are introducing a new and improved phone system to make it easier for you to contact us and get the care you need, when you need it. These changes are designed to improve your experience and help us manage calls and requests more efficiently.

What’s Changing?

With our new system, you’ll benefit from:

✅ Patient Callback – No more waiting on hold! You can request a callback, and we’ll return your call as soon as you reach the front of the queue.

✅ Clearer Menu Options – Our updated menu will guide you to the right team faster – or better still, to resources that can help you without the need to speak to us – whether you need an appointment, a prescription request, test results, or general advice.

✅ SMS Notifications & Signposting – Receive text messages with updates, appointment confirmations, and links to useful health services. This will help direct you to the most appropriate care option, whether it’s a self-care resource, pharmacy, or Healthcare Professional.

✅ Check and Cancel – You can now check and/or cancel your appointments more easily through our phone system, helping free up slots for others and reduce waiting times.

What This Means for You :

  • Faster and easier access to the right care and support
  • Reduced waiting times on the phone
  • More flexibility with callbacks
  • Clearer information about services and appointments
